English: Mosbolletjies is sweetened , leavened yeast bun flavoured with caraway and or anise seed. Apparently they were introduced by the French Huguenots settlers. The name comes from the "mos" or fermenting grape must used as a raising agent along with yeast and because they are shaped like little balls, They can be dried to make rusks.
